Html css在下拉列表中有另一个下拉列表
我有这段代码Html css在下拉列表中有另一个下拉列表,html,css,twitter-bootstrap-3,drop-down-menu,Html,Css,Twitter Bootstrap 3,Drop Down Menu,我有这段代码 <li class="dropdown" runat="server" id="btn_logout"> <a href="#" class="dropdown-toggle" data-toggle="dropdown"><i class="fa fa-user">USER</i> <b class="caret"></b></a> <ul class="dropdown-menu"
<li class="dropdown" runat="server" id="btn_logout">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><i class="fa fa-user">USER</i> <b class="caret"></b></a>
<ul class="dropdown-menu" style="background-color:black;">
<li class="dropdown-header">DROPDOWN HERE: </li>
<li><a href="#">Manage Account</a></li>
<li role="separator" class="divider"></li>
<li><a href="logout.php">Sign Out</a></li>
</ul>
</li>
- 下拉列表:
我想有另一个下拉列表,上面写着下拉这里
。
我怎样才能做到这一点?简短回答,引导程序上的子菜单
(TLDR)正如你所想象的,有一些黑客:
。下拉子菜单{
位置:相对位置;
}
.下拉子菜单>.下拉菜单{
排名:0;
左:100%;
利润上限:-6px;
左边距:-1px;
-webkit边界半径:0 6px 6px 6px;
-moz边界半径:0 6px 6px;
边界半径:0 6px 6px 6px;
}
.下拉子菜单:悬停>.下拉菜单{
显示:块;
}
.下拉子菜单>a:之后{
显示:块;
内容:“;
浮动:对;
宽度:0;
身高:0;
边框颜色:透明;
边框样式:实心;
边框宽度:5px 0 5px 5px;
左边框颜色:#ccc;
边缘顶部:5px;
右边距:-10px;
}
.下拉子菜单:悬停>a:之后{
左边框颜色:#fff;
}
.下拉式子菜单.向左拉{
浮动:无;
}
.下拉子菜单.向左拉>.下拉菜单{
左-100%;
左边距:10px;
-webkit边界半径:6px 0 6px 6px;
-moz边界半径:6px 0 6px 6px;
边界半径:6px 0 6px 6px;
}
-
您不能通过单击来完成,因为在子下拉列表中单击将关闭第一个。但是,当您将鼠标悬停在所需元素上时,可以使用CSS打开子下拉列表。欢迎使用StackOverflow!随着时间的推移,你会看到,这并不是“请寻求帮助”。我们经常会面临无法找到答案的疑问,我们可以利用这样的社区来帮助我们。这个社区要求你写出好的问题,如果你想在这方面做得更好,我建议你花点时间阅读这篇文章。